Hunting Avian-X TurNew Decoys | Avian-X Lcd Feeder Hen Turkey Decoy

$60.29

Hunting Avian-X TurNew Decoys | Avian-X Lcd Feeder Hen Turkey Decoy

SKU: YAHIEO9290569-8760XPWK Categories: , ,